OBJECTIVE: Patients with autoimmune disease (AD) are at increased risk for complications from COVID-19 infection, so, optimizing vaccine utilization in this population is of particular importance. We compared COVID-19 vaccination perspectives among persons with and without AD. METHODS: 471 patients in the MetroHealth System and Cleveland Veteran Affairs Medical Center completed a 38-item questionnaire between August 2021 and February 2022. This survey containing questions regarding COVID-19 vaccine perceptions and demographics was administered both to unvaccinated individuals and individuals who delayed vaccination for at least 2 months. Multivariable ordinary least squares regression models were created to assess factors associated with vaccination likelihood. RESULTS: The number of reasons given for (p < 0.001) and against receiving COVID-19 vaccination (p < 0.001) were highly associated with increased and decreased vaccination likelihood respectively. Factors most closely associated with obtaining vaccine were: protecting family (p = 0.045) personal safety (p < 0.001) and preventing serious infection (p < 0.001). Reasons associated with decreased vaccination likelihood were: lack of concern of COVID-19 infection (p < 0.001), vaccine safety (p < 0.001) and beliefs that the vaccine was made too quickly (p = 0.024). AD patients were more likely to cite having a chronic condition (29.1 % vs 17.1 %, p = 0.003) and physician recommendation(s) (18.4 % vs 9.1 %, p = 0.005) as reasons for vaccination and were more concerned about potential medication interaction than non-AD respondents (22.4 % vs 3.3 %, p < 0.001). CONCLUSION: The number of benefits of vaccination identified strongly related to vaccination likelihood. Affirmative provider recommendations correlated with increased vaccination likelihood in AD patients. Clinical conversations centered on the benefits of COVID-19 vaccination may help increase vaccine acceptance.

BACKGROUND: Declining COVID-19 vaccination rates have led to implementation of monetary incentives to increase vaccine uptake. The Ohio Vax-a-Million lottery and subsequent $100 incentives were created to encourage individuals to become vaccinated. The purpose of this survey was to determine the efficacy of these monetary incentives on vaccination rates. METHODS: A 38-item questionnaire was given to outpatients at MetroHealth and Cleveland Veteran Affairs Hospitals between August 2021 and February 2022 who either waited 2 or more months to receive the COVID-19 vaccination or have not yet been vaccinated. The survey contained questions regarding demographics and perceptions of COVID-19 monetary incentives on vaccination likelihood. RESULTS: Of the 471 participants surveyed, 0.95% reported that the Ohio Vax-a-Million lottery increased their vaccination likelihood, while 29.7% reported that it decreased their likelihood. 6.8% of respondents reported the $100 incentive increased their vaccination likelihood while 17.4% reported it decreased their vaccination chances. 20.6% of participants stated news of the Delta (δ) variant increased their vaccination likelihood. CONCLUSION: Our study results suggest that monetary incentives were not associated with increased COVID-19 vaccination rates. Instead, more participants believed that these incentives decreased their vaccination likelihood. Expansion of the survey across a wider sociodemographic range can provide further evidence of the efficacy of these programs before reimplementation.

UNLABELLED: Cell-based therapy has potential therapeutic value in autoimmune diseases such as rheumatoid arthritis (RA). In RA, reduction of disease activity has been associated with improvement in the function of regulatory T cells (Treg) and attenuated responses of proinflammatory effector T cells (Teff). Mesenchymal stem cells (MSCs) and related multipotent adult progenitor cells (MAPC) have strong anti-inflammatory and immunomodulatory properties and may be able to "reset" the immune system to a pre-RA state. MAPC are MSC-like cells that are slightly earlier in lineage, have greater expansion capacity, and can be used as "off-the-shelf" therapy. Assessment of cell-based therapy to treat arthritis and related diseases is limited by the lack of available biological correlates that can be measured early on and indicate treatment response. We set out to develop a functional measure that could be used ex vivo as a biomarker of response. We were able to demonstrate that MAPC products could inhibit Teff responses from patients with active RA and that Treg from RA patients suppressed Teff. This assay used ex vivo can be used with MAPC or Treg alone or in combination and reflects the overall level of Teff suppression. Use of a novel functional biomarker as an exploratory endpoint in trials of cell-based therapy should be of value to detect biological outcomes at a point prior to the time that clinical response might be observed. SIGNIFICANCE: Therapy with mesenchymal stem cells and related multipotent adult progenitor cells is immune modifying in a variety of diseases. There is interest in using cell-based therapy in rheumatoid arthritis (RA) to induce tolerance and "reset" the immune system to its pre-RA state. In a clinical trial, it should be known as soon as possible if there is a chance of response. A biomarker has been developed that permits measurement of the effects of cell-based therapy on effector T cell function.

OBJECTIVE: To demonstrate the usefulness of a novel medical device based on Raman spectroscopy for the rapid point-of-care diagnosis of gout and pseudogout. METHODS: A shoebox-sized point-of-care Raman spectroscopy (POCRS) device was developed for use in the diagnosis of gout and pseudogout. The device included a disposable syringe microfiltration kit to collect arthropathic crystals from synovial fluid and a customized automated Raman spectroscopy system to chemically identify crystal species. Diagnosis according to the findings of POCRS was compared with the clinical standard diagnosis based on compensated polarized light microscopy (CPLM) of synovial fluid aspirates collected from symptomatic patients (n = 174). Kappa coefficients were used to measure the agreement between POCRS and CPLM findings. RESULTS: Overall, POCRS and CPLM results were consistent in 89.7% of samples (156 of 174). For the diagnosis of gout, the kappa coefficient for POCRS and CPLM was 0.84 (95% confidence interval [95% CI] 0.75-0.94). For the diagnosis of pseudogout, the kappa coefficient for POCRS and CPLM was 0.61 (95% CI 0.42-0.81). CONCLUSION: Kappa coefficients indicated that there was excellent agreement between POCRS and CPLM for the diagnosis of gout, with good agreement for the diagnosis of pseudogout. The POCRS device holds the potential to standardize and expedite the time to clinical diagnosis of gout and pseudogout, especially in settings where certified operators trained for CPLM analysis are not available.
